Masi explains stewards decision not to penalise Leclerc
Ferrari's already troubled season suffered another major blow on Sunday when Sebastian Vettel and Charles Leclerc collided on the opening lap of the Styrian Grand Prix. After both cars retired, Leclerc immediately apologised for causing the collision, acknowledging that "What happened today is clearly my fault, there's nothing else to say. "I take full responsibility. I made a mistake and apologising is not enough," he continued. "I was so eager to do well for the team, and I thought I might be able to gain three or four places and I went for it. But in fact the opportunity wasn't there.
